Igor Suprunyuck and Viktor Sayenko, both 19, and Alexander Hanzha became famously known by the media as The " Dnepropetrovsk Maniacs" for the gruesome murder-sprees they committed. By the time they were arrested, 21 lives were taken and families and friends forever broken by the horrible death's their loved ones had to endure.

Igor Suprunyuk was eventually convicted of 21 murders, Viktor Sayenko of 18. Both of them were sentenced to life in prison. Both men are still detained in prison. Sayenko's parents have been particularly outspoken about their son's alleged innocence, calling him a scapegoat and the victim of unfair sentencing.

Viktor Sayenko claimed that his son was a scapegoat, and that the crimes were committed by relatives of senior officials. The parents plan to appeal to the Supreme Court of Ukraine and the European Court of Human Rights. The parents of Suprunyuk and Sayenko also argued that the sentence on Alexander Hanzha was too lenient.

The Dnepropetrovsk Maniacs is the media epithet for the killers responsible for a string of murders in Dnepropetrovsk, Ukraine in June and July 2007. The case gained additional notoriety because the killers made video recordings of some of the murders, with one of the videos leaking to the Internet. Murders The first two murders occurred late on 25 June 2007. The first victim was a 33-year-old woman, Yekaterina Ilchenko, [9] who was walking home after having tea at her friend's apartment. According to Sayenko's confession, he and Suprunyuk were "out for a walk". Suprunyuk had a hammer.

Who are Dnepropetrovsk Maniacs? Viktor Sayenko, Igor Suprunyuk, and Alexander Hanzha were schoolmates. By the age of 14, they had forged a strong friendship based on certain commonalities. Sayenko and Suprunyuk had both experienced bullying, and they soon discovered a shared fear of heights.
